DSP嵌入式系统综合设计案例精讲

本书特色

[

本书系统介绍了dsp嵌入式系统开发的基础知识和应用设计案例,内容共分3篇:第1篇为开发基础篇,重点介绍了dsp嵌入式系统开发的基础知识和集成开发环境;第2篇为模块实例篇,通过典型模块实例介绍了dsp嵌入式系统中典型模块的设计技术,包括数字输入/ 输出、事件管理器、模数转换、串行外设接口等模块,书中案例的程序设计大部分采用c语言编程;第3篇为综合应用篇,是本书的重点,精选出了14个具体的dsp嵌入式系统综合应用案例的完整设计过程。本书语言简洁,层次分明,精选的每个应用案例都对具体的案例背景、设计思路分析、硬件电路设计、软件设计、参考程序、分析与小结做了详细的描述和注释,为读者提供了一套完整的dsp嵌入式系统综合设计方法。本书可供从事dsp应用与产品开发等工作的工程技术人员学习使用,也可作为高等院校毕业设计和电子设计竞赛的参考用书。

]

内容简介

[

本书具有以下特点:(1)本书是一本实用技术书。要求读者具有数字电路与模拟电路、自动控制原理、信号与系统、dsp原理、c语言程序设计等基础知识。(2)本书分3篇共15章内容。第1篇为开发基础篇,重点介绍了dsp嵌入式系统开发的基础知识和集成开发环境。第2篇为模块实例篇,通过典型案例介绍了dsp嵌入式系统中典型模块的设计技术,包括数字输入/输出、事件管理器、模数转换、串行外设接口等模块,案例的程序设计大部分采用c语言编程。第3篇为综合应用篇是本书的重点,精选出了14个具体的dsp嵌入式系统综合应用案例。对每个案例的选题背景、设计思路分析、硬件电路设计、软件设计、参考程序、分析与小结等六个方面进行了详细的阐述。精选的每个案例在程序设计上给出了汇编语言和c语言的源程序。有利于读者举一反三,达到快速掌握dsp嵌入式系统综合应用的目的。(3)本书突破了传统的软硬件截然隔裂的方法,使读者对dsp嵌入式系统的开发有一个整体的了解。相信本书的这个特点会节省读者进入dsp领域的时间,同时能更清楚认识dsp嵌入式系统开发的方法和步骤。(4)本书从应用的角度出发,结合了作者多年教学、科研实践所取的经验,系统、全面地以dsp应用案例介绍嵌入式系统开发的全过程,是一本实用教程。(5)案例多。读者在学习的过程中,全书将通过大量的dsp实际应用案例阐述了完整的设计过程,通过这些案例的学习,读者可较为容易掌握dsp嵌入式系统综合设计方法。 

]

目录

第1篇 开发基础篇 1第1章 dsp应用系统开发 11.1 概述  11.2 dsp芯片  21.2.1 dsp芯片的发展   21.2.2 dsp芯片的分类   31.2.3 dsp芯片的架构   41.3 dsp应用系统    61.3.1 dsp应用系统构成   61.3.2 dsp应用系统特点    81.3.3 dsp*小系统设计     91.4 dsp应用系统开发流程   101.4.1 dsp总体方案设计   101.4.2 dsp芯片选择     111.4.3 硬件电路设计    131.4.4 软件程序设计   141.4.5 dsp系统集成      161.4.6 dsp应用系统开发工具   16小结  17第2章 dsp嵌入式系统集成开发环境 182.1 ccs简介  182.1.1 ccs概述  182.1.2 代码生成工具 192.2 ccs3.3的基本应用 202.2.1 开发tms320c28xx应用系统环境 202.2.2 ccs3.3安装  202.2.3 ccs3.3设置  202.2.4 启动ccs3.3仿真  242.3 典型实例:用ccs3.3开发一个音频信号采集、处理输出的程序 262.3.1 实例目的  262.3.2 实例原理  272.3.3 实例步骤  272.3.4 实例结果  33第2篇 模块实例篇 34第3章 数字输入/输出模块 343.1 i/o端口概述  343.2 i/o端口寄存器  343.3 i/o端口应用实例  383.3.1 键盘接口设计  383.3.2 lcd显示接口设计 41第4章 事件管理器模块 544.1 事件管理器模块概述 544.1.1 事件管理器结构框图 544.1.2 事件管理器寄存器地址列表 554.1.3 事件管理器中断 564.2 通用定时器 624.2.1 通用定时器概述 624.2.2 通用定时器功能模块 634.2.3 通用定时器的计数操作 694.3 事件管理器应用实例 724.3.1 事件管理器产生pwm波的应用 724.3.2 捕获单元的应用 74第5章 模数转换模块 775.1 模数转换模块(adc)概述 775.2 自动排序器的工作原理 775.2.1 连续的自动排序模式 785.2.2 排序器的启动/停止模式 785.2.3 输入触发源 785.3 adc时钟预定标 795.4 校准模式 795.5 自测试模式  805.6 adc模块的寄存器 805.7 adc转换时钟周期 875.8 模数转换模块应用实例 87第6章 串行外设接口模块(spi) 906.1 串行外设接口概述 906.2 串行外设接口操作 916.2.1 操作介绍 916.2.2 串行外设接口模块 916.2.3 串行外设接口中断 926.2.4 数据格式 926.2.5 串行外设接口波特率设置和时钟方式 936.2.6 串行外设接口的初始化 946.3 串行外设接口控制寄存器 956.4 串行外设接口模块应用实例 100第7章 串行通信接口模块(sci) 1037.1 串行通信接口概述 1037.2 多处理器(多机)异步通信模式 1047.2.1 串行通信接口可编程的数据格式 1047.2.2 串行通信接口的多处理器通信 1057.2.3 串行通信接口通信格式 1057.2.4 串行通信接口中断 1077.2.5 串行通信接口波特率计算 1077.3 串行通信接口控制寄存器 1087.4 串行通信接口模块应用实例 1127.4.1 串行通信硬件电路设计 1127.4.2 串行通信软件设计 112第8章 can控制器模块 1158.1 can控制器模块概述 1158.1.1 can技术简介 1158.1.2 tms320 lf2407 can 控制器概述 1158.2 邮箱 1168.2.1 can信息包格式说明 1168.2.2 can邮箱寄存器 1178.3 can控制寄存器 1188.4 can控制器的操作 1288.4.1 初始化can控制器 1288.4.2 信息的发送 1298.4.3 信息的接收 1298.4.4 远程帧 1308.5 can控制器模块应用实例 1318.5.1 can模块发送一个远程帧请求 1318.5.2 can模块自动应答一个远程帧请求 133第3篇 综合应用篇 136第9章 dsp在电力系统中的应用 1369.1 光伏并网逆变器的设计实例 1369.1.1 实例功能 1369.1.2 设计思路 1369.1.3 工作原理 1379.1.4 硬件电路 1399.1.5 软件设计 1439.1.6 参考程序 1459.2 风力发电并网逆变器的设计实例 1589.2.1 实例功能 1589.2.2 设计思路 1589.2.3 工作原理 1599.2.4 硬件电路 1609.2.5 软件设计 1649.2.6 参考程序 164第10章 dsp在开关电源中的应用 17210.1 直流斩波电源的设计实例 17210.1.1 实例功能 17210.1.2 工作原理 17210.1.3 硬件电路 17310.1.4 软件设计 17610.1.5 参考程序 17710.2 三相高精度逆变电源的设计实例 18510.2.1 实例功能  18510.2.2 工作原理 18510.2.3 硬件电路 18810.2.4 软件设计 19010.2.5 参考程序 191第11章 dsp在电动机控制系统中的应用 23111.1 异步电动机矢量控制的设计实例 23111.1.1 实例功能  23111.1.2 工作原理 23211.1.3 硬件电路 23311.1.4 软件设计 23611.1.5 参考程序 24111.2 感应电动机软启动器的设计实例 24511.2.1 实例功能 24611.2.2 工作原理 24611.2.3 硬件电路 24711.2.4 软件设计 24911.2.5 参考程序 251第12章 dsp在检测系统中的应用 25912.1 三相交流参数测试仪的设计实例 25912.1.1 选题背景 25912.1.2 设计思路分析 25912.1.3 硬件电路设计 26412.1.4 软件设计 26612.1.5 参考程序 27012.1.6 分析与小结 27912.2 lcr 数字电桥设计实例 27912.2.1 选题背景 27912.2.2 设计思路分析 28012.2.3 硬件电路设计 28112.2.4 软件设计 28412.2.5 参考程序 28612.2.6 分析与小结 299第13章 dsp在数字系统中的应用 30013.1 基于dds 的信号发生器的设计实例 30013.1.1 设计背景 30013.1.2 设计思路分析 30013.1.3 硬件电路设计 30213.1.4 软件设计 30613.1.5 参考程序 31013.1.6 分析与小结 31413.2 数字频率特性测试仪的设计实例 31413.2.1 选题背景 31413.2.2 设计思路分析 31513.2.3 硬件电路设计 31613.2.4 软件设计 32113.2.5 参考程序 32513.2.6 分析与小结 330第14章 dsp在数字通信中的应用 33114.1 数字电话终端系统的设计实例 33114.1.1 设计背景 33114.1.2 设计思路分析 33114.1.3 硬件电路设计 33214.1.4 软件设计 33514.1.5 参考程序 33814.1.6 分析与小结 34314.2 数字接收机设计实例 34414.2.1 设计背景 34414.2.2 设计思路分析 34414.2.3 硬件电路设计 34614.2.4 软件设计 34914.2.5 参考程序 35114.2.6 分析与小结 358第15章 dsp在数字音像系统中的应用 35915.1 嵌入式语音门锁系统的设计实例 35915.1.1 设计背景 35915.1.2 设计思路分析 35915.1.3 硬件电路设计 36115.1.4 软件设计 36415.1.5 参考程序 36715.1.6 分析与小结 37715.2 智能阅读系统的设计实例 37715.2.1 设计背景 37715.2.2 设计思路分析 37815.2.3 硬件电路设计 37815.2.4 软件设计 38315.2.5 参考程序 38415.2.6 分析与小结 391附录  392附录a 抗干扰系统设计 392a.1 器件、软件与频率抖动技术 392a.1.1 器件、软件与emc  392a.1.2 频率抖动技术与emc 393a.2 相关设计实例 393a.2.1 语音门锁电路板抗干扰及抗esd 的布线设计 393a.2.2 飞控嵌入式系统硬件抗干扰措施 394a.2.3 基于dds 的信号发生器电路抗干扰措施 395a.2.4 数字频率特性测试仪电路板抗干扰设计与调试 396附录b 常用程序 399b.1 外扩展存储器程序 399b.2 自适应滤波器程序 405b.3 键盘监控程序 408b.4 中断服务程序 412参考文献 436

封面

DSP嵌入式系统综合设计案例精讲

书名:DSP嵌入式系统综合设计案例精讲

作者:魏伟

页数:435

定价:¥98.0

出版社:化学工业出版社

出版日期:2016-05-01

ISBN:9787122262721

PDF电子书大小:32MB 高清扫描完整版

百度云下载:http://www.chendianrong.com/pdf

发表评论

邮箱地址不会被公开。 必填项已用*标注